John Steele land survey notebook, 1874-1884
Item — Box: 3, Folder: 1
Identifier: Vault MSS 528 Series 6 Item 1
Scope and Contents
Notebook used by Steele to document land surveys he was involved in for various purposes, including mining, farming, and town plots in Southern Utah. Includes the initial town plots of Springdale, Shonesburg, and Rockville. An 1874 Hanauer, Kohn and Company clothing price list catalog was used for the notebook. Dated 1874-1884.
